From f8a500d96b7c9cb2c9438dde3f9acfde96788f08 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Kristian=20H=C3=B8gsberg?= Date: Thu, 13 May 2010 16:06:29 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] egl: Allow a prioritized list of default drivers When there is no user driver or any matching display drivers we fall back to the default driver. This patch lets us have a list of default drivers instead of just one. The drivers are loaded in turn and we attempt to initialize the display. If it fails we unload the driver and move on to the next one. Compared to the display driver mechanism, this avoids loading a number of drivers and then only using one. Also, we call Initialize to see if the driver will work instead of relying on Probe.
